The IMF mission is to issue a statement today capping their two weeks of talks in Kyiv. Led by led by Ron van Rooden, the team stayed longer than planned. Today, it flies back to Washington apparently without a staff level agreement on a new Extended Fund Facility. Without this agreement, talks continue at the Oct 14-20 Annual General Meeting of the IMF in Washington. Ukraine seeks to win a 3-year, $5 billion deal. More than the money, an IMF deal is a seal of approval for foreign investors.
